About Sheetal Parida

Sheetal Parida is a scholar working on Toxicology, Biotechnology and Oncology, having authored 46 papers that have together received 1.5k indexed citations. Recurring topics across this work include Gut microbiota and health (13 papers), Cancer Research and Treatments (6 papers) and Nanoparticle-Based Drug Delivery (5 papers). The work is most often cited by research in Cancer Research (245 citations), Oncology (386 citations) and Biomaterials (161 citations). Sheetal Parida has collaborated with scholars based in United States, India and Hungary. Frequent co-authors include Dipali Sharma, Sumit Siddharth, Mahitosh Mandal, Chiranjit Maiti, Dibakar Dhara, Nethaji Muniraj, Ipsita Pal, B. N. Prashanth Kumar, Arumugam Nagalingam and Kathleen L. Gabrielson. Their work appears in journals such as Cancer Research, ACS Applied Materials & Interfaces and International Journal of Molecular Sciences.
